SEMO to Offer George Floyd Memorial Scholarship

Logo

Southeast Missouri State University is establishing a scholarship in honor of George Floyd.
Southeast accepted a challenge from North Central University, a Christian university in Minneapolis, which called on every college and university in America to establish a George Floyd Memorial Scholarship in memory of the man, whose recent death in Minneapolis has spurred national discussion.

Southeast Missouri State University President Carlos Vargas tweeted he and his wife Pam were the first to contribute to the fund, which will be awarded for the first time this fall. The goal is $10,000.
